Home foundation leveling services involve assessing and correcting issues related to the stability and alignment of a property's foundation. Skilled contractors typically evaluate the foundation to identify unevenness, cracks, or settling problems that may compromise the structural integrity of the building. Once issues are diagnosed, the process often includes lifting or stabilizing the foundation using specialized equipment and techniques. The goal is to restore the foundation to its proper position,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the property's safety and value.
These services address common problems such as u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ation shifts.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ction can lead to foundation settlement or sinking. Foundation leveling helps mitigate these issues by providing a stable base for the entire structure, reducing the risk of more extensive damage or costly repairs in the future. Properly leveled foundations also contribute to the overall safety and comfort of the property’s occupants.

Basement and Foundation Repairs - Local pros offer foundation leveling services to address uneven or sinking foundations, helping to stabilize structures. They utilize various methods to restore proper alignment and support.
Concrete Slab Leveling - Contractors can lift and level sunken or uneven concrete slabs to improve safety and functionality around residential properties. This service is often used for driveways, patios, and walkways.
Structural Stabilization - Foundation leveling specialists provide solutions to reinforce and stabilize compromised foundations, preventing further damage to the home’s structure. They focus on restoring the foundation’s integrity.
Mudjacking and Foam Jacking - These techniques involve injecting materials beneath the foundation or slabs to raise and level them, offering a cost-effective alternative to replacement. Local providers can recommend suitable options based on the situation.
Crack Repair and Prevention - Foundation leveling services often include sealing and repairing cracks to prevent water intrusion and further structural issues. Proper repair helps maintain the home’s stability over time.
Soil Stabilization Services - Experts may perform soil stabilization to improve ground conditions that cause foundation settling, ensuring a more durable and even foundation for residential buildings. Local pros assess soil needs to determine the best approach.

What are signs that a home needs foundation leveling? Indicators include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ks.
How long does a foundation leveling service typ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the settlement, but most projects can be completed within a few days.
What methods do local pros use for foundation leveling? Common techniques include mudjacking, piering, and underpinning to stabilize and lift the foundation.
Is foundation leveling a disruptive process? While some minor disruptions may occur, experienced contractors aim to minimize impact on daily activities during the work.
